About Itchan-Kala

Itchan-Kala is the historical museum, the walled inner city of Khiva, Uzbekistan. It is famously known as a beautifully preserved example of a Central Asian medieval city and was the first site in Uzbekistan to be designated a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Walking through its massive clay walls feels like stepping directly into an ancient story. The city is celebrated for its stunning blue-tiled minarets, grand mosques, and old madrasahs, all concentrated in one incredible spot. The colours and history here are truly captivating.

Point of Interest for Itchan-Kala

Kalta Minor Minaret

A short, colourful tower known for blue-green tiles and impressive presence in the old city.

Kunya-Ark Fortress

Ancient royal residence with throne rooms, courtyards, and tall watchtowers for city views.

Islam Khoja Minaret

The highest tower in Khiva, giving wide views across mud-brick houses and desert edges.

Juma Mosque

A peaceful mosque with wooden pillars carved centuries ago and soft light filling the hall.

Tash-Hauli Palace

A royal home built with great detail, showcasing tilework, courtyards, and traditional living spaces.
